The Role of Display Typography in Visual Communication
In graphic design, typography is more than just letters; it’s a primary vehicle for personality and tone. While body text requires neutrality, display fonts like Just Retro are designed to command attention. Its rounded, chunky letterforms evoke a sense of warmth and approachability, making it an excellent tool for brands that want to appear friendly, energetic, or nostalgic without feeling dated.
Effective visual hierarchy relies on contrast. By pairing a distinctive display font with a clean sans-serif or serif for body copy, designers can create a clear path for the viewer's eye. Just Retro excels in this role, ensuring headlines, logos, and key messages are instantly readable and emotionally resonant.

Integrating Fonts into a Cohesive Design Workflow
Choosing the right creative assets is a strategic decision. When evaluating a display font like Just Retro, consider its scalability and readability across different sizes and mediums. Test it against your existing color palette to ensure harmony. A font’s visual weight should complement, not compete with, other design elements such as imagery and icons.
Consistency is key to professional presentation. Once selected, document its usage within your brand guidelines—specifying appropriate sizes, spacing, and pairing fonts. This ensures all team members and future projects maintain a unified visual language, strengthening overall brand identity.
